Mergers & Acquisitions
A successful business might be poised to acquire another enterprise. Or, that same business becomes attractive as a partner for a merger. All of this involves complex financial documents. Our attorney works with clients not just on preparing the documents but ensuring that the client understands all that is going into the legal aspects of the transaction.
Are there any potential antitrust issues involved with an acquisition or merger? This can involve discussions with the appropriate regulatory agencies. Financing has to be worked out. The roles and responsibilities of everyone involved with the merger need to be clarified. New company policies and guidelines may have to be developed. The Ongoing Life Of The Business
When a business seeks out investors, there are legal issues inherent in that process. The corporate structure of the business has implications for how investment can be sought. Those putting money into the business will have their own objectives, and an attorney can put together documents that ensure everyone’s goals are being met.
The hiring and compensation process must protect the legal needs of the business. An experienced attorney can coordinate with human resources protect the firm from any liability that could arise from an inequitable pay scale.
A business that needs loans is wise to get legal counsel on the final terms of the credit agreement. Seemingly small details can turn into a very big deal, and a business owner needs the peace of mind that comes from knowing their lawyer is on top of all those details.
